Q:Will this run a CPAP machine which uses about 95 watts. How lo g might the charge last
by|Mar 26, 2023
2 Answers
Answer This Question
A: I did a little research on the Home Depot website. With the Milwaukee power inverter, a 32-inch tv will power for about 280 minutes using the HD12.0 battery. The average consumption of a 32-inch LED TV is 41 watts/hr. Since you mentioned that your machine uses 95 watts, I guess it is safe to say that the HD12.0 should last about two hours (120 mins).

Q:Can you use the High Output 12A Battery in the Orbital Polisher/
by|Nov 7, 2022
1 Answer
Answer This Question
A: You can use any M18 battery with any M18 tool. The only caveat is some tools have clearance issues with larger batteries. The orbital polisher is balanced with the 6ah battery so it will be handle heavy with a 12ah on it.

Q:I have twelve M18 Milwaukee tools from nail guns, drills, to the new mower. I also have 1.5ah, 2.0ah, 5.0ah and the 12ah batteries that came with the mower. My question is can all these different batteries work in all of my tools without damaging the tool
by|Sep 7, 2022
5 Answers
Answer This Question
A: Yes , they will work in any 18 volt Millwaukee tool. You are never going to damage a tool by using a stronger 18 volt battery. If anything if you use the smaller batteries on heavy duty tools you will wear the battery out quicker. If you use 2 AH batteries on a right angle drill all the time you will wear the battery out quicker to the point where it won’t hold a charge .
